Relative Search:
Baidu Google
Edit this listing

Bio Filtration Systems

2341 Porter Lake Dr Unit 101
Sarasota , FL 34240
941-343-9300

Driving Directions

From:
To: 2341 Porter Lake Dr Unit 101 ,Sarasota , FL 34240